
AN inquiry set up to discover why some women have traumatic experiences in childbirth has called for an overhaul of the UK’s maternity and postnatal care reports the BBC.
The Birth Trauma Inquiry heard “harrowing” evidence from more than 1,300 women – some said they were left in blood-soaked sheets while others said their children had suffered life-changing injuries due to medical negligence.
